Vacations / holidays in Garmisch-Partenkirchen
Garmisch-Partenkirchen (Germany) is a town in Bavaria in the south of Germany near the boarder to Austria. It is situated in the Oberbayern region and is the administrative centre of the district of Garmisch-Partenkirchen. South of Partenkirchen is the Partnach Gorge ''Partnach Klamm'', where the river ''Partnach'' surges spectacularly through a long but narrow gap between high cliffs. The tallest mountain of Germany, the Zugspitze is south of Garmisch near the village of Grainau. Nice to visit is also the King's House on Schachen, a small castle built for King Ludwig II of Bavaria. It is located in the mountains south of Garmisch-Partenkirchen and contains the ''Alpengarten auf dem Schachen'', an alpine botanical garden.
